Humana Inc. (Symbol: HUM) is a leading healthcare and wellness company headquartered in Louisville, Kentucky, specializing in offering a diversified range of health insurance, wellness programs, and managed care plans to individual, group, government, and military customers. With a strong commitment to providing personalized, affordable, and high-quality healthcare solutions, Humana emphasizes on simplifying access and meeting the evolving needs of its vast clientele through leveraging data analytics, technology, and innovation. As a publicly traded entity, Humana’s stock is listed on the New York Stock Exchange, and it forms part of the esteemed S&P 500 index, reflecting its significant impact and presence within the highly competitive healthcare sector.

Humana Inc. (HUM.US) - FY2025 Annual Report

Humana's financial position appears to be under considerable strain. While total revenue reached a record $129.7 billion, reflecting consistent top-line expansion, profitability has deteriorated sharply. Net income for FY2025 came in at approximately $1.19 billion, which is less than half of what the company earned just two years earlier and represents a negative compound annual growth rate of around 20% over the past four years. The stock price, at $257.84, sits near a five-year low, which could suggest the market has been pricing in these headwinds.

The most striking feature is the persistent compression of profitability despite growing revenues. The operating margin, which stood above 4% in FY2022, has been halved to just over 2%. Similarly, the net margin has dwindled to under 1%. This divergence between revenue growth of about 10% year-over-year and a slight decline in net income could indicate significant pressure on the company's medical cost ratios. The benefits expense line, which represents the core cost of providing care, appears to be the primary driver, having grown to over $110 billion and outpacing premium revenue growth in a way that has squeezed the spread.
